1. Department of Surgery, University of Turku, Department of Pathology, University of Turku
2. The Department of Clinical Physiology, University of
Lund, Malmö, Sweden
3. Department of Pediatric Surgery, University of Turku, Paavo Nurmi Center, University of Turku, Turku, Finland
4. Department of Pathology, University of Turku